Key Responsibilities
• Record and maintain accurate accounting transactions in compliance with company policies and accounting standards.
• Manage accounts payable and receivable, process invoices, and handle payments.
• Perform monthly bank reconciliation and manage petty cash.
• Prepare and submit monthly/quarterly/annual tax declarations (VAT, PIT, CIT, etc.).
• Communicate daily with our Korean Headquarters and our Thai parent company to report on financial status, address any discrepancies, and ensure accounting processes are aligned with global standards.
• Assist with month-end and year-end closing processes.
• Prepare financial statements and management reports for submission to regional and HQ teams.
• Participate in internal and external audits as required.
• Assist in budgeting, forecasting, and implementing internal control improvements.
• Bachelor’s degree in accounting, Finance, or related field.
• Minimum 2–3 years of accounting experience, preferably in an international or manufacturing company.
• Strong knowledge of accounting principles and Vietnamese tax regulations.
• Proficiency in MS Excel; experience with accounting software (e.g., SAP, QuickBooks) is an advantage.
• Excellent communication skills in both English and Korean are a must.
• Detail-oriented, reliable, and able to work independently as well as part of a cross-cultural team.
